This is the RCA Dome or better known to people who have been in Indiana for a while, the Hoosier Dome. It opened in 1984. It took 2 years to build and cost $82 million. It has been the home of the Colts since they arrived from Baltimore and also the home to many other events. My sister was part of the Lebanon High School marching band that won the state competition here during its opening year. It also has hosted 4 Men’s NCAA Final Four basketball tournaments and 1 Woman’s NCAA Final Four tournament. The Hoosier Dome was renamed the RCA Dome in 1994. It is currently being prepped for implosion.
